FYI: History of Plumbing

This post, let's reflect on how far we've come in plumbing, so we can all appreciate innovations in technology in this area.

The world's first water closet was in 2000 BCE in India - it really amount to not much more than a pot of water. However, when the aqueduct came around during the 7th Century BCE in Greece, plumbing really began to take off.

The first flush toilet has a relatively short life, as it was invented in 1596 by Sir John Harrington. But still, pipe systems weren't in place until the 1800s, and the 1830s saw the modern sewer system put into place in the US. Of course, it wasn't until 1890 or so that the average person acquired a toilet.
